Puerperal women's satisfaction with the obstetric services received: improvement of an assessment instrument
ABSTRACT Objectives: to improve an instrument that measures postpartum women's satisfaction with obstetric care. Methods: action research, developed from a preliminary version of an instrument prepared by nurse-midwives working in public services in the Federal District. The analysis of the res...
